Ticket #F-2291 — Cleaning crew access, Harwick House

Hi reception team, quick one: the Brightmop crew starts their new evening rota on Monday, arriving around 18:30 instead of 20:00. They'll come through the side lobby, so please buzz them in and log them as usual. Kira from Brightmop will lead the team. For the supply cupboard on level 2, they'll need the following pass:

door code, yagap-bahof: bdg-O-05

Ticket #— Floor 9 Opening Prep, Brindlemoor House

Hi facilities folks, Floor 9 opens to staff next Monday and we need a few things squared away before then. Lift access is live, but the two side doors by the kitchenette are still on the old lock config — please reprogram them before Friday. Also, signage for the quiet rooms hasn't arrived, so pop up the temporary printed ones for now. Until the badge readers sync, the interim door code for Floor 9 is below.

door code, bajop-bajog: bdg-DSWAC-43621

Handover — webhook delivery retries (Crowbeck dispatcher)

Retries are exponential with jitter, capped at six attempts; after that, events land in the dead-letter table for manual replay. 429s pause the whole endpoint, not just the event. Nothing in flight needs action before the release. Verify the dispatcher picks up these settings on restart; current values are below.

service settings:
PRAIX_LOG_LEVEL=error
PRAIX_METRICS_HOST=metrics.praix.qorvelcorp.corp
PRAIX_POOL_SIZE=16